Lubbock, TXThe Lubbock Lake Landmark, also known as Lubbock Lake Site, is a significant archeological site and natural history preserve located in the city of Lubbock, Texas. The preserve spans an impressive 336 acres and is protected as a state and federal landmark. Lubbock, TXThe American Wind Power Center, located in Lubbock, Texas, is a museum dedicated to wind power. It is situated on 28 acres of city park land to the east of downtown Lubbock. The museum boasts an exhibition of over 160 American style windmills, making it a unique destination for those interested in the history and technology of wind power. 5Museum of Texas Tech University
Lubbock, TXThe Museum of Texas Tech University, located in Lubbock, Texas, is a comprehensive institution that includes the main museum building, the Moody Planetarium, the Natural Science Research Laboratory, and the research and educational elements of the Lubbock Lake Landmark and the Val Verde County research site.
